PHP を使用して簡単なオンライン借用機能を開発する方法
インターネットの急速な発展に伴い、オンライン借用機能はますます多くの企業に不可欠な部分になってきました。図書館と読書室の重要な機能。オンライン貸出機能により、対象書籍の関連情報を素早く簡単に照会し、予約貸出・更新・返却などの操作を行うことができます。この記事では、PHPを使用して簡単なオンライン融資機能を開発する方法と、具体的なコード例を詳しく説明します。
要約すると、PHP を使用して、ユーザー登録とログイン、書籍のクエリと管理、貸出記録の管理を含む、簡単なオンライン貸出機能を開発します。合理的なシステム設計とデータベース構築、および PHP バックエンド スクリプトの作成により、シンプルで実用的なオンライン融資システムを迅速に実装できます。
参考コード例:
// 连接数据库 $host = 'localhost'; $dbname = 'library'; $username = 'root'; $password = ''; try { $conn = new PDO("mysql:host=$host;dbname=$dbname", $username, $password); } catch(PDOException $e) { echo "数据库连接失败: " . $e->getMessage(); exit; } // 用户注册 $username = $_POST['username']; $password = $_POST['password']; $stmt = $conn->prepare("INSERT INTO users (username, password) VALUES (?, ?)"); $stmt->bindParam(1, $username); $stmt->bindParam(2, $password); if($stmt->execute()) { echo "注册成功"; } else { echo "注册失败"; } // 用户登录 $username = $_POST['username']; $password = $_POST['password']; $stmt = $conn->prepare("SELECT * FROM users WHERE username = ? AND password = ?"); $stmt->bindParam(1, $username); $stmt->bindParam(2, $password); $stmt->execute(); if($stmt->rowCount() > 0) { echo "登录成功"; } else { echo "用户名或密码错误"; } // 图书查询 $keyword = $_GET['keyword']; $stmt = $conn->prepare("SELECT * FROM books WHERE title LIKE ?"); $stmt->bindValue(1, "%$keyword%"); $stmt->execute(); while($row = $stmt->fetch(PDO::FETCH_ASSOC)) { echo $row['title']; } // 借阅记录查询 $user_id = $_SESSION['user_id']; $stmt = $conn->prepare("SELECT * FROM borrow_records WHERE user_id = ?"); $stmt->bindParam(1, $user_id); $stmt->execute(); while($row = $stmt->fetch(PDO::FETCH_ASSOC)) { echo $row['book_id']; }
上記は、PHP を使用して簡単なオンライン借用機能を開発するための主な手順とコード例です。開発者は、実際のニーズに基づいて適切な調整や拡張を行い、より完全で安定したオンライン融資システムを実現できます。
以上がPHPを使用して簡単なオンライン借用機能を開発する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。